Game Overview

Pu Nu Jing Ling is an unlicensed NES game from China, released without official Nintendo approval. It was developed and distributed by unknown entities during the peak of the Famicom clone market, a time when unofficial cartridges flooded certain regions. The game fits right into that era of low-budget, often experimental titles that operated outside mainstream publishing channels.

You control a small, agile character who navigates side-scrolling stages filled with platforms and enemies. The main goal is to reach the end of each level while collecting items and avoiding hazards. Signature mechanics include screen-by-screen progression, temporary power-ups that alter your attack or mobility, and simple, repetitive enemy patterns. The pacing is brisk but uneven, and the difficulty can feel unpredictable due to occasional design quirks. Itโ€™s a short, rough-edged experience that feels distinctly homemade.
